Powerful Incinerators for Increased Capacity
Modern medical waste incinerators are engineered to handle large volumes of waste efficiently and effectively. These incinerators feature:
- Increased combustion chambers and airflow systems to handle greater loads.
- Advanced fuel and air management technologies for complete combustion and reduced emissions.
- Automated feeding and charging systems for seamless operation and improved safety.
- Continuous monitoring and control systems to ensure optimal performance and regulatory compliance.
Enhanced Environmental Protection
Powerful incinerators prioritize environmental sustainability through:
- HEPA filtration systems to capture hazardous particulate matter.
- Selective catalytic converters to reduce harmful gases.
- Advanced ash handling and disposal solutions to minimize environmental impact.
